Antiquarian collections in two unidentified hands, 17th century
File
MS. Top. Yorks. c. 44
Held at the Weston Library
Antiquarian collections in two unidentified hands, 17th century, written in a 16th-century legal precedent book, including (fols. 15-42) a list of nobles created from the Conquest to the reign of Mary Tudor, with notes on their lives.

Custodial History
Signature of Francis Wortley, 1663, on fols. 2 and 3.
